TitleBoiling Pot, Noosa National ParkAdditional InformationFrom the 'Coloured Shell Series' of postcards.
This series of postcards were produced from 1905 to about 1915.
This series was processed using Photochrome, this was a process for producing colourised images from black and white photo negatives via the direct photographic transfer of a negative onto lithographic printing plates. The process is a photographic variant of chromolithography (colour lithography).
